In sharp contrast, Anne Begg initially saw her role quite differently: "When I was elected first, I was actually quite keen not to be seen as the disabled MP and if anything, I probably shied away from even talking about disability issues.
Anne Begg's colleagues actually did the most intelligent thing to try to accommodate her when they learned it was likely that she would be elected to a seat in Parliament - they simply asked her what she needed.
Begg describes being approached by the Chairman of the Ways and Means Committee in 1997 and being asked if it looked likely that she would win.

Disability groups have defended MP Anne Begg's £20,000 rise in allowances, as they say it highlights the need for disabled people to have extra resources.
Ms Begg, who is a wheelchair user, can now claim a third more than the normal office cost allowance of £47,569 a year and a third more than the additional costs allowance of £12,287 for a London home.
But Begg says the rise is in line with Government policy because it helps her do her job.

 Aberdeen South   (Site not responding. Last check: 2007-10-21)
In 1997, the winner was Labour's Anne Begg who obtained a handsome 3,365 majority over Liberal Democrat Nichol Stephen, with previous Tory MP Raymond Robertson trailing 555 votes behind in third place.
By the 2001 Westminster election, Anne Begg had made very little impact in the four years which she spent at Westminster and seemed, by many, to be resigned to losing her seat.
At the 2001 Wstminster election, Anne Begg was returned to Westminster with 39.8 % of the vote and a 4,388 majority of the Lib Dem's Cll Ian Yuill with 27.9 %.

 BBC NEWS | Scotland | MP's fury at rail 'cattle truck'
A Scottish Labour MP who uses a wheelchair has said she was forced to travel in "little better than a cattle truck" during a railway journey.
Anne Begg, who represents Aberdeen North, had to travel in the guard's van on a Southern Railways slam-door train from London to Dorking last Tuesday.
Ms Begg, who suffers from a genetic condition called Gaucher's disease, had intended to travel from London Bridge to Dorking.
